Abstract

An image capturing apparatus having a camera shake correction function, includes an optical system, a movable member that is movable on a plane perpendicular to an optical axis of the optical system to achieve the camera shake correction function, an angular velocity detector configured to detect an angular velocity of shake of the image capturing apparatus and generate a detection signal, and a controller configured to drive the movable member based on the output from the angular velocity detector. The controller includes a time change rate limiter configured to limit a time rate of change of angular velocity indicated by the detection signal output from the angular velocity detector to be no greater than a predetermined limiting value, and drive the movable member based on the detection signal output through the time change rate limiter.

Claims (14)

1. An image capturing apparatus having a camera shake correction function, comprising:

an optical system;

a movable member configured to move on a plane perpendicular to an optical axis of the optical system, to achieve the camera shake correction function;

an angular velocity detector configured to detect an angular velocity of shake of the image capturing apparatus and generate a detection signal; and

a controller configured to drive the movable member based on an output from the angular velocity detector, wherein:

the controller:

includes a time change rate limiter configured to limit a time rate of change of angular velocity indicated by the detection signal output from the angular velocity detector to be no greater than a predetermined limiting value; and

drives the movable member based on the detection signal output through the time change rate limiter;

wherein when the time rate of change of angular velocity indicated by the detection signal from the angular velocity detector exceeds a predetermined reference value, the controller drives the movable member while limiting the time rate of change of angular velocity indicated by the detection signal to be no greater than the predetermined limiting value;

wherein the predetermined limiting value is set at a value which is not less than a value of an angular acceleration which is observed due to a user's hand movement during shooting of an image; and

wherein the predetermined limiting value is set at a value which is not less than 400 deg/s 2 .

2. The image capturing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the movable member is a lens.

3. The image capturing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the movable member is an imaging device for generating image data from an optical signal.

4. The image capturing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the controller is a microcomputer for providing a function by executing predetermined programs.
